ABOUT US

Goldberg Segalla is a law firm more than 350 lawyers strong. With over 20 offices, our footprint reaches from Los Angeles to London, with teams based in New York, Chicago, Philadelphia, Miami, St. Louis, and other major business and economic centers across 10 states. We counsel and protect the interests of regional, national, and international clients in a wide range of industries. For more information, please visit our website.
